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General »

[SOLUCIONADO] Duda con diseño de base de datos

Estas en el tema de Duda con diseño de base de datos en el foro de Bases de Datos General en Foros del Web. Bueno, estaba trabajando en un diseño de una base de datos sencilla, en la que hay unas parcelas, que entre otros atributos tienen un tipo ...
  #1 (permalink)  
Antiguo 08/06/2015, 14:53
 
Fecha de Ingreso: septiembre-2010
Mensajes: 494
Antigüedad: 13 años, 6 meses
Puntos: 10
Duda con diseño de base de datos

Bueno, estaba trabajando en un diseño de una base de datos sencilla, en la que hay unas parcelas, que entre otros atributos tienen un tipo de cultivo.

Hasta hoy, tenía una tabla con los diferentes tipos de cultivo, la cual estaba relacionada mediante un id en la tabla de parcelas. Vamos, hasta ahí todo muy sencillo.

Pero hoy me he dado cuenta de que hay parcelas que pueden tener más de un cultivo, y esa realidad no se puede obviar.
Además debería reflejar la superficie dedicada a cada cultivo. Y no sé si es que a estas horas no funciono, pero algo que me parecía fácil me está resultando difícil de visualizar.

¿Alguna idea o consejo de cómo enfocar esto?

Muchas gracias por adelantado.
__________________
Mi calculadora en Qt
  #2 (permalink)  
Antiguo 08/06/2015, 15:04
Avatar de Libras
Colaborador
 
Fecha de Ingreso: agosto-2006
Ubicación: En la hermosa perla de occidente
Mensajes: 7.412
Antigüedad: 17 años, 8 meses
Puntos: 774
Respuesta: Duda con diseño de base de datos

tabla intermedia

Parcelas
id nombre

Parcelas_cultivos
id-parcela id_cultivo

Cultivos
id nombre
__________________
What does an execution plan say to t-sql query? Go f**k yourself, if you are not happy with me
  #3 (permalink)  
Antiguo 08/06/2015, 15:17
 
Fecha de Ingreso: septiembre-2010
Mensajes: 494
Antigüedad: 13 años, 6 meses
Puntos: 10
Respuesta: Duda con diseño de base de datos

Hola Libras, gracias por responder.
Esa era la primera idea, pero el hecho de que tenga que reflejar la superficie asociada a cada cultivo es lo que no me deje ver esa opción como algo claro.
__________________
Mi calculadora en Qt
  #4 (permalink)  
Antiguo 08/06/2015, 15:20
Avatar de Libras
Colaborador
 
Fecha de Ingreso: agosto-2006
Ubicación: En la hermosa perla de occidente
Mensajes: 7.412
Antigüedad: 17 años, 8 meses
Puntos: 774
Respuesta: Duda con diseño de base de datos

Parcelas
id nombre

Parcelas_cultivos
id-parcela id_cultivo superficie

Cultivos
id nombre
__________________
What does an execution plan say to t-sql query? Go f**k yourself, if you are not happy with me
  #5 (permalink)  
Antiguo 08/06/2015, 15:23
 
Fecha de Ingreso: septiembre-2010
Mensajes: 494
Antigüedad: 13 años, 6 meses
Puntos: 10
Respuesta: Duda con diseño de base de datos

Cita:
Iniciado por Libras Ver Mensaje
Parcelas
id nombre

Parcelas_cultivos
id-parcela id_cultivo superficie

Cultivos
id nombre
¡Muchas gracias!
__________________
Mi calculadora en Qt

Etiquetas: diseño, tabla
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 08:14.